Daily Beast Editor John Avlon Likens Mike Pence To Segregationist George Wallace (NewsBusters)

On Monday's New Day on CNN, Daily Beast editor-in-chief John Avlon likened Indiana Governor Mike Pence's defense of his state's new religious freedom law to George Wallace's fight for racial segregation. Avlon asserted that Republican politicians "don't want to say they're in favor of bigotry. So what you get is that incredibly awkward stonewalling by Mike Pence." He added that "this puts him in the same position as George Wallace...by saying that...I'm not in favor of segregation. I never have been. This is about states' rights and the Constitution."

The CNN analyst also underlined that social conservative pressing this issue is "the tyranny of dog whistle politics...These politicians are terrified to vote against this because they don't want to be seen – and vulnerable in a primary challenge – people who say they aren't Christian enough and aren't conservative enough." Avlon later contended that the backlash against Governor Pence would sink any presidential aspirations: "Whenever there's this kind of pandering to the outer reaches of politics, it ends up having unintended consequences that derail national ambitions. Pence's blowback is going to be significant."
